Affordable Hearing Aids: Options for Every Budget
Hearing loss impacts millions of people worldwide, and the cost of hearing aids can be a significant barrier to treatment. Luckily, there are now many budget-friendly options available that make hearing healthier more accessible.
Since you're on a tight budget or simply looking for value, research the following choices:
* Over-the-shelf hearing aids are becoming increasingly popular due to their simplicity. These devices can be purchased directly from pharmacies without a prescription.

Used or refurbished hearing aids can offer significant savings compared to purchasing new ones. Be sure to buy from a reputable source and have the devices inspected by an audiologist before use.

Many insurance plans now include at least some of the cost of hearing aids. Contact your plan administrator to find out what your benefits are.
Non-profit organizations such as the Hearing Loss Association of America may offer financial assistance programs or savings on hearing aids.
Where to Buy Hearing Aids: Navigating Your Choices
Hearing loss is a common condition that can affect people of all ages. If you're experiencing hearing difficulties, it's important to explore professional help. One crucial step in managing your hearing loss is finding the right hearing aids. There are many different options available, and choosing the best pair for you can be overwhelming. This article will assist you through the process of where to purchase hearing aids.
Your journey might begin at your general physician's office. They can conduct a basic hearing test and recommend you to an audiologist for a more comprehensive evaluation. Audiologists are specialists who assess hearing problems and prescribe the most suitable hearing aids based on your individual needs.
- You can also contact a local hearing center or specialist clinic. These facilities often have experienced audiologists who can provide you with expert advice and fitting services.
- In recent years, the availability of hearing aids remotely has increased. Many reputable stores now offer a comprehensive selection of hearing aids directly to consumers.
It's important to remember that choosing hearing aids is a personal decision. What works best for one person may not be the ideal solution for another. Take your time, explore your choices, and discuss qualified professionals to confirm you find the hearing aids that appropriately meet your expectations.
